As fires rage feds cut funding on prevention
federal government is spending less and less on its main program for preventing blazes in the first place. A combination of government austerity and the ballooning cost of battling the ruinous fires has taken a bite out of federal efforts to remove the dead trees and flammable underbrush that clog Western forests. DIA tornado rated EF-1
DENVER - The tornado that touched down at Denver International Airport on Tuesday was an EF-1.The Enhanced Fujita scale rates tornadoes on a scale of zero to five, based on wind speed and damage.An EF-1 tornado has wind gusts of 65-85 mph, The peak gust hit 97 mph, according to the 24/7 Weather Center.The tornado touched down east of the airport around 2:22 p.m., sending about 10,000 travelers ...
